DS/EN ISO 9241-8

Ergonomic requirements for office work with visual display terminals (VDTs) - Part 8: Requirements for displayed colours

inactive, Most Current
Organization: DS
Publication Date: 14 November 1997
Status: inactive
Page Count: 36
ICS Code (IT terminal and other peripheral equipment): 35.180
ICS Code (Ergonomics): 13.180
scope:

This standard describes minimum ergonomic requirements and recommendations to be applied to colours assigned to text and graphic applications and images in which colours are discretely assigned. The specifications in this standard exclude photorealistic images and graphics. This standard applies to both hardware and software for visual display terminals, because both these sources control the presentation and appearance of colour on the display screen.
